Cooking Montreal: tarte au chocolat

1. In bowl, beat together icing sugar and butter until smooth.
2. Whiski together vinegar and egg yolk; beat into butter mixture.
3. Stiri in almonds.
4. Stir in flour and salt to make soft dough.
5. Let stand for 10 minutes.
6. On lightly floured surface, roll out dough to ΒΌ-inch thickness.
7. Transfer to 9-inch tart pan with removable bottom.
8. Trim, using extra dough to patch any tears in pastry.
9. Refrigerate for 30 minutes.
10. Prick pastry shell all over with fork.
11. Bakei in 425f 220c oven for 12-15 minutes.
12. Filling: in top of double boiler over hot (not boiling) water, heat half of the cream, stirring constantly with wooden spoon, until almost boiling.
13. Remove from heat; stir in chocolate until melted and smooth.
14. Blend in remaining cream.
15. Pour into pastry shell; refrigerate for 1 hour or until set. Toppingi: in small heavy saucepan, cook sugar over medium-high heat until melted and golden brown.
16. Immediately plunge bottom of pan into cold water for 15 seconds.
17. Working quickly, dip 2 of the hazelnuts into sugar and place on foil-lined baking sheet.
18. Repeat with remaining hazelnuts.
19. Let cool.
20. Place around edge of pie.
